The reports were that Star Wars Alum, Oscar Issac is in talks to play the complex character, Marc Spector. While this casting is still not set in stone, we have more news about the production team.

According to Deadline, Clash director Mohamed Diab has been brought in to direct Moon Knight. Currently, nobody has made an official comment, but the word is that the Egyptian filmmaker is onboard. Jeremy Slater is Moon Knight‘s showrunner, leading the writing team for the series.

Who Is Moon Knight?

Moon Knight aka Marc Spector is a mercenary with a variety of alter egos. One is a cabbie named Jake Lockley, millionaire Steven Grant, and the all-white dressed Mr. White. He uses these personalities to better fight the criminal underworld. It was later established that he was a conduit for the Egyptian moon god Khonshu. The character was created by Doug Moench and Don Perlin and appeared in Werewolf by Night #32 in August of 1975.
